Abstract: This paper describes an estimation and representation method for object structure in 2D and 3D imagery. Local image features are modelled with Gaussian intensity profiles and estimated by a combination of a multiresolution, windowed Fourier approach followed by an iterative, minimum mean-square estimation. The method is computationally efficient and robust, giving accurate estimates of feature position, orientation and size. A structure classification and inference scheme is proposed, which...
